## Further Reading

So, about log sampling: the Quillcast gateway emits roughly a million lines an hour, and nobody wants to pay to store all of that. We use adaptive sampling via the Sievebird sidecar — errors always pass through, info lines get throttled by endpoint. Tuning the ratios wrong can hide real incidents, so read the config docs before touching anything. The full sampling policy and tuning guide is here:

runbook for kawef-hahif: https://jira.lumicsys.internal/projects/browse/display/c08d703c

# FeeForge Environments

Quick refresher for the sync: FeeForge (our shipping-fee rules engine) runs in three environments — sandbox, staging, and prod. Sandbox resets nightly, staging mirrors prod rules with a day's lag, and prod is the one Marisol guards jealously. Rule promotion goes sandbox → staging → prod, no skipping. Each environment picks up its own settings at boot, shown here for prod:

deployment values, kajep-kageg:
[praix]
host = praix.paliqcorp.corp
user = praix_svc
database = praix_prod

Subject: Fire drill Thursday — roll call duty

Hi reception folks,

Quick heads-up: fire drill is Thursday at 10:30. Grab the clipboard from the cabinet behind the desk and do roll call at the Hollybrook Lane assembly point. You'll need to unlock the cabinet first — the pass code for it is below.

Thanks!

door code, yagap-bahof: bdg-O-05